Introduction

AI Translation

The JFET-input operational amplifiers of the TL06x series are designed as low-power versions of the TL08x series amplifiers. They feature high input impedance, wide bandwidth, high slew rate, and low input offset and input bias currents. The TL06x series features the same terminal assignments as the TL07x and TL08x series.

Features

  • Very Low Power Consumption Typical Supply Current: 200 μA (Per Amplifier)
  • Wide Common-Mode and Differential Voltage Ranges
  • Low Input Bias and Offset Currents
  • Common-Mode Input Voltage Range Includes VCC+
  • Output Short-Circuit Protection
  • High Input Impedance: JFET-Input Stage
  • Internal Frequency Compensation
  • Latch-Up-Free Operation
  • High Slew Rate: 3.5 V/μs Typical
  • On Products Compliant to MIL-PRF-38535, All Parameters Are Tested Unless Otherwise Noted. On All Other Products, Production Processing Does Not Necessarily Include Testing of All Parameters.
